Baker's One Bowl Brownies Recipe

Ingredients:

4 squares Baker's unsweetened chocolate
¾ cup butter or margarine
2 cups sugar
3 eggs
1 tsp. vanilla
1 cup flour
1 cup nuts, chopped (optional)

Directions:

Heat oven to 350ºF for glass baking dish. Microwave chocolate and margarine in large microwavable bowl on high for 2 minutes or until margarine is melted. Stir until chocolate is completely melted. Stir sugar into chocolate until well blended. Stir in nuts. Spread in greased 9" x 13" pan. Bake 30-35 minutes or until toothpick inserted in center comes out with fudgy crumbs. Do not overbake.
